Ukraine has demonstrated what seems to be the primary fruits of its acknowledged willpower to improve home drone manufacturing, with the announcement it has despatched over 2,000 nationally manufactured UAVs to its protection forces, together with 3,000 first-person view craft (FPV).
The primary information merchandise was revealed by Ukraine Minister of Digital Transformation, Mykhailo Fedorov, who posted a statement on social media concerning the massive cargo of newly minted drones to protection forces.
Although Fedorov stated the craft had been “aircraft-type UAVs,” pictures he posted with the announcement contained primarily quadcopters Ukraine forces have been deploying for quite a lot of missions – together with bombing strikes on enemy positions.
Then, simply this morning, the Ukraine25 fundraising group behind the nation’s “Military of Drones” initiative said 3,000 “bought” FPV craft had been distributed amongst entrance line forces for assault missions.
The deployment of the full 5,000 drones comes lower than a month after Ukraine officers stated efforts had been being made to extend volumes of home manufacturing of UAVs to tens of hundreds per 30 days.
Whereas clearly wanting that goal set for 12 months’s finish, the batch of latest craft was a sign that manufacturing of comparatively massive numbers of the autos had certainly change into a significant precedence because the protection forces put together to shift from the summer time counter-offensive to winter battle methods.
Fedorov additionally took steps to emphasize the significance and effectiveness that drones have had in Ukraine’s protection actions. By the use of instance, he stated that final week alone, Ukraine UAVs had succeeded in destroying or incapacitating 39 Russian tanks, 34 armored autos, 57 artillery batteries, and 307 strategic positions.

Earlier within the month, Ukraine’s supporters across the globe had been inspired to assist finance the nation’s response to the continuing assaults by contributing $24 {dollars} or extra for an opportunity to win a specifically created set of Lego.
In mid-November, United24 stated it had co-founded the #LEGOwithUKRAINE challenge, an initiative approved by the Danish toy firm. It affords individuals donating funds for the reconstruction of Ukraine an opportunity to win a one among three completely different units, whose meeting respectively create nationwide landmarks – together with Kyiv’s Mom of Ukraine statue.
5 of every of the three collection will probably be distributed in a raffle following the drive’s November 28 cut-off date.
